State County CityCity Type ?In many cases, a ZIP Code can have multiple "names", meaning cities, towns, or subdivisions, in its boundaries. However, it will ALWAYS have exactly 1 "default" name. D - Default - This is the "preferred" name - by the USPS - for a city. Each ZIP Code has one - and only one - "default" name. In most cases, this is what people who live in that area call the city as well. A - Acceptable - This name can be used for mailing purposes. Often times alternative names are large neighborhoods or sections of the city/town. In some cases a ZIP Code may have several "acceptable" names which is used to group towns under one ZIP Code. N - Not Acceptable - A "not acceptable" name is, in many cases, a nickname that residents give that location. According to the USPS, you should NOT send mail to that ZIP Code using the "not acceptable" name when mailing.ZIP Code

ZIP Code 13808 Plus 4 ZIP Code 13808 Plus 4

ZIP Code 5 plus 4 is the extension of 5-digit zip code, It can be used to locate a more detailed location. The last four digits designate segment or one side of a street or an apartment. You can find the ZIP+4 code and corresponding address of the zip code 13808 below.

13808 Basic Meaning Basic Meaning

What does each digit of ZIP Code 13808 stands for? The first digit designates a national area, which ranges from zero for the Northeast to nine for the far West. The 2-3 digits are the code of a sectional center facility in that region. The last two digits designate small post offices or postal zones.

Households for ZIP Code 13808 Households for ZIP Code 13808

ZIP code 13808 has 748 households, with an average number of 2.36 persons per household. The average income per household in Zip code 13808 is 49,375 USD, and the average house value is 135,500 USD.

Geographic Geographic

The latitude of the Zip code 13808 is 42.529028, the longitude is -75.255752, and the elevation is 1086. It has land area of 36.799 square miles, and water area of 0.067 square miles. The time zone for ZIP code 13808 is Eastern (GMT -05:00). Daylight saving time should be observed in the area where the zip code is located.

Social Security Benefits Social Security Benefits

There are 480 beneficiaries with benefits in current-payment status for ZIP code 13808, of which 345 are retired workers, 70 are disabled workers, 25 are widow(er)s and parents, 15 are spouses and 25 are children. The number of beneficiaries aged 65 or older is 360. The total monthly benefits are 655,000 USD, of which 504,000 USD for retired workers, 35,000 USD for widow(er)s and parents.
